This week, Jadyn Davis, a five-star Michigan football quarterback, will be competing in the Elite 11 finals alongside some of the nation’s best players. Earlier this week, Davis lost his composite five-star status due to dropping in the new rankings from ON3 and Rivals. However, in interviews leading up to the skills showcase, Davis spoke highly of the Maize and Blue fans and the program’s culture.

Five-star Michigan football quarterback commit Jadyn Davis raves about fans and culture in Ann Arbor

Jadyn Davis is the crown jewel of Jim Harbaugh’s 2024 recruiting class. The five-star quarterback commit is a significant addition for the Wolverines, as they aim to extend their national title window through the 2024 class and beyond.

Recently, when interviewed by ON3 ahead of the Elite 11 finals in Los Angelas, CA, Jadyn Davis couldn’t say enough about his new program.

“It’s a great deal of pride an honor and I’m extremely grateful for the whole Michigan fan base,” Davis said. “They’ve shown me nothing but love. If anybody says anything at me, they attack them. They’ve shown me love. I’m representing them and the whole Michigan program and that brand when I’m out there. I do that each and every day…I’m trying to show Michigan in the most positive light possible and be victorious as well.”

Jadyn Davis will be competing this weekend alongside notable players such as CJ Carr (Notre Dame), Air Noland (Ohio State), Ethan Grunkemeyer (Penn State), and many others. Although he lost his composite five-star status earlier this week, Jadyn Davis still has ample time to recover lost ground before National Signing Day next year. A remarkable performance in LA this week could potentially propel him back to the top position.
